In our lessons, you'll learn the fundamentals of the instrument in a creative and positive way that applies to all styles of music, from classical to jazz and beyond.  We focus on expanding range and endurance, developing tone and articulation, and on phrasing and musicianship. We can work on repertoire, preparing for exams and auditions, as well as improvisation and composition. My goal is to help you grow as a trumpet player, and to play the music you love!

I am proud to have a diverse studio including beginners, amateur players, and professional musicians of all backgrounds and styles, from 5 to 75 years old. I have experience teaching those with physical and intellectual disabilities. I studied extensively in New York with master teacher Laurie Frink, the foremost exponent of Carmine Caruso's universally effective method. I combine this approach with methods I’ve developed throughout my teaching and performing careers. I am fluent in English and French.
